  • Arbitrary waveform generators

    Staff -- Test & Measurement World, 12/1/2005 2:00:00 AM

    The CompuGen family of PCI arbitrary waveform generators offers 12-bit resolution at digital-to-analog conversion rates of up to 1 billion samples/s. The CompuGen 11G, CompuGen 4300, and CompuGen 8150 provide one, four, and eight channels, respectively, with conversion rates of 1 billion samples/s, 300 million samples/s, and 150 million samples/s. Each comes with 4 Msamples of onboard memory (up to 16 Msamples on the CompuGen 8150). Free software for creating, editing, and generating waveforms is included, along with development kits for C/C++, MATLAB, and LabView. Base price: $4495. Gage Applied Technologies, www.gage-applied.com.
